Terms-Cash or cheque with I.D. 91 RUMNEY AND BLACK AUCTIONEERS INC. - Bob Rumney Les Black 534-3572 429-5084 Executers or Auctioneers not responsible for loss or accident day of sale-Lunch available. \ y, THE FARM CREDIT CORPORATION OFFERS FOR SALEBY PUBLIC AUCTION A farm located ap- proximately 5 kms. East of Edgar, on a gravel road, ap- proximately one half mile north of the old Barrie Road. .LEGAL DESCRIPT- ION: West '» of Lot 8, Concession 8, Oro Township, Simcoe County. LAND: Approximately 100 acres with 85 workable. Balance hardwood bush and building site. BUILDINGS: Two storey, aluminum sided, five bedroom dwelling. Conventional two storey bank barn with dairy stabling and milk house. Additional buildings include small barn and four mink sheds. Note: Telecommuni- cations tower on the property, providing $1,000 income annually and covers part of the taxes. The successful bidder must provide a certified cheque, bank draft, or money Order payable to Farm Credit Cor- poration for a minimum of $5,000. at time of sale. Auction to be held Saturday, November 26, 1983, at 10 a.m. on the property.
